Social media platforms have become a primary source of entertainment for millions around the world. Platforms like TikTok, YouTube, and Instagram have empowered individuals to create and share their own content, leading to the rise of the "influencer" and the democratization of media. User-generated content often feels more authentic and relatable than traditional media, fostering a sense of community and connection among viewers. OpenAI’s Sora and similar text-to-video models threaten to collapse the production cost of visual media entirely. Soon, a single person with a prompt will be able to generate a full-length feature film. This will democratize storytelling infinitely but also flood the ecosystem with low-quality, derivative sludge. The scarcity will no longer be production but curation —finding the good stuff in an infinite sea of junk.

Generative AI has reached the point where synthetic media is indistinguishable from reality. Deepfakes of celebrities (and ordinary people) are used for revenge porn, political sabotage, and blackmail. As entertainment content becomes easier to forge, the concept of "trust" in media decays.
